ENG v IND 2021: Despite crushing loss, not looking at wholesale changes for Oval Test – Aakash Chopra

The fourth Test of the series will begin on September 2nd and will be played at the Oval in London.

India will be looking to come back strongly in 4th Test at Oval after inns loss in Leeds | GettyFormer India opener Aakash Chopra said that despite the Leeds Test being a crushing one as England beat India by an innings and 76 runs in the third Test match, the visitors must not make wholesale changes for the upcoming fourth Test at the Oval.

India was blown away on day one after being bowled out for 78 runs in the 1st innings and then in the second innings were decimated on the fourth morning after having put up some resistance on the third day.

In a video shared on his YouTube channel, Aakash Chopra pointed out that India has more or less a settled combination even though they might have been handed a thrashing.

"Of course, it is a crushing loss. When you lose by an innings and more runs, you know you have been completely outplayed but you are not looking at wholesale changes. In the first innings, you were dismissed for 78 and in the second innings if you had hypothetically folded for 150, then it would have been catastrophic,” Chopra said.  

Chopra praised Pujara and Kohli's knock in second innings | GettyFurthermore, Chopra highlighted the performances of Cheteshwar Pujara and Virat Kohli in the second innings as positives for the Indian team.

"Now you have batted the entire third day, of course, it would have been better if you had batted a little better on the fourth day. You got important runs from Cheteshwar Pujara and the way he played, Virat Kohli got his first half-century. These are two very important elements that I feel will be in India's favor,” he added.

He pointed out that only Ishant Sharma’s performance was the concerning thing for India, while Ravindra Jadeja, Rohit Sharma, and everyone else did well despite the crushing loss.

He said: "Ravindra Jadeja took two wickets and scored a few runs as well. He has been continuously doing that. Rohit Sharma is continuing in that same form. Only Ishant Sharma's performance has gone slightly down, the rest of them have done decently well. Rahul's form is not a concern as he has come after scoring runs, one match can go bad. Pujara, Kohli, Rohit - everyone has scored runs."
